Fix building transmission with C++23 (#6832)
* fix: operator== should return bool in tr_strbuf

Fixes build error with C++20/C++23

error: return type 'auto' of selected 'operator==' function for rewritten '!=' comparison is not 'bool'

Signed-off-by: Dzmitry Neviadomski <nevack.d@gmail.com>

* fix: explicitly specify Blocklist::size() return type as size_t

Fixes building with C++20/C++23
error: no matching function for call to 'size'
function 'size' with deduced return type cannot be used before it is defined

Signed-off-by: Dzmitry Neviadomski <nevack.d@gmail.com>

* fix: wrap runtime format strings with fmt::runtime in library, daemon and cli

fmt::format_string ctor is consteval with C++20
See https://github.com/fmtlib/fmt/issues/2438

#include <chrono>
#include <string>
#include <string_view>
#include <fmt/core.h>
#define LIBTRANSMISSION_WATCHDIR_MODULE
#include "libtransmission/error-types.h"
#include "libtransmission/error.h"
#include "libtransmission/file.h"
#include "libtransmission/log.h"
#include "libtransmission/tr-strbuf.h"
#include "libtransmission/utils.h" // for _()
#include "libtransmission/watchdir-base.h"
using namespace std::literals;
namespace libtransmission
{
namespace
{
[[nodiscard]] constexpr std::string_view actionToString(Watchdir::Action action)
{
switch (action)
{
case Watchdir::Action::Retry:
return "retry";
case Watchdir::Action::Done:
return "done";
}
return "???";
}
[[nodiscard]] bool isRegularFile(std::string_view dir, std::string_view name)
{
auto const path = tr_pathbuf{ dir, '/', name };
auto error = tr_error{};
auto const info = tr_sys_path_get_info(path, 0, &error);
if (error && !tr_error_is_enoent(error.code()))
{
tr_logAddWarn(fmt::format(
fmt::runtime(_("Skipping '{path}': {error} ({error_code})")),
fmt::arg("path", path),
fmt::arg("error", error.message()),
fmt::arg("error_code", error.code())));
}
return info && info->isFile();
}
} // namespace
namespace impl
{
void BaseWatchdir::processFile(std::string_view basename)
{
if (!isRegularFile(dirname_, basename) || handled_.count(basename) != 0)
{
return;
}
auto const action = callback_(dirname_, basename);
tr_logAddDebug(fmt::format("Callback decided to {:s} file '{:s}'", actionToString(action), basename));
if (action == Action::Retry)
{
auto const [iter, added] = pending_.try_emplace(std::string{ basename });
auto const now = std::chrono::steady_clock::now();
auto& info = iter->second;
++info.strikes;
info.last_kick_at = now;
if (info.first_kick_at == Timestamp{})
{
info.first_kick_at = now;
}
if (now - info.first_kick_at > timeoutDuration())
{
tr_logAddWarn(fmt::format(fmt::runtime(_("Couldn't add torrent file '{path}'")), fmt::arg("path", basename)));
pending_.erase(iter);
}
else
{
setNextKickTime(info);
restartTimerIfPending();
}
}
else if (action == Action::Done)
{
handled_.emplace(basename);
}
}
void BaseWatchdir::scan()
{
auto error = tr_error{};
for (auto const& file : tr_sys_dir_get_files(dirname_, tr_basename_is_not_dotfile, &error))
{
processFile(file);
}
if (error)
{
tr_logAddWarn(fmt::format(
fmt::runtime(_("Couldn't read '{path}': {error} ({error_code})")),
fmt::arg("path", dirname()),
fmt::arg("error", error.message()),
fmt::arg("error_code", error.code())));
}
}
} // namespace impl
} // namespace libtransmission
